The transcript discusses a meeting with the Secretary of State about pay disputes in the NHS. Despite a civil discussion, no tangible commitments were made to resolve the issue. The Secretary of State acknowledged the need for investment, but the Treasury holds the key to unblocking funds. The government is urged to act to prevent strikes and address the challenges faced by NHS workers, who are dealing with severe conditions. The emphasis is on saving the NHS and ensuring all workers are supported, highlighting the interconnectedness of different NHS sections.
